About CoComply
CoComply is building AI-native External Workforce Management, the control layer that brings services spend under management at major corporations, typically 500 to 5,000 employees.
Services spend, consultants, contractors, agencies, SOW suppliers, is the second-largest line on the corporate P&L and the least governed. It falls between HR, Procurement, Legal and Finance, owned by no function and tracked by no system end to end. Worker classification rules have made that gap expensive, and in the UK, HMRC has shown it will collect.
CoComply is the control layer that fixes this. We closed our venture round in April 2026, have real revenue traction with recognisable enterprise names in the pipeline, and are building for a multi-billion pound global market.
The Opportunity
We are hiring our second Founding Account Executive, joining a growing commercial team as we scale. You'll report directly to the Sales Director and work alongside our first AE and our SDRs.

This is a genuine 360 role. You'll build roughly half your pipeline yourself through outbound and network, and close the other half from meetings booked by our SDR team. You'll run the full cycle: discovery, demo, business case, negotiation, close.
This is a foundational hire for someone who wants real ownership early. You'll help shape how CoComply sells, not inherit a playbook that's already fixed.
What You Will Own
Pipeline Generation
- Build and work a balanced pipeline: roughly 50% self-sourced through your own outbound and network, 50% from SDR-generated meetings
- Prospect into target accounts across CFO, HR Director, Procurement Director and Tax functions at large UK employers
- Work closely with SDRs to sharpen targeting, messaging and handover quality
Full-Cycle Sales
- Run discovery using a structured, question-led methodology, not a pitch
- Lead demos, build business cases, and negotiate commercial terms including multi-year agreements
- Own forecast accuracy and CRM hygiene in HubSpot across every stage of your pipeline
Playbook & Team
- Feed real prospect language, objections and win/loss insight back into the sales process
- Partner with the Sales Director on quota setting, deal strategy and territory planning
- Support SDR development, including joint calls and coaching where useful

What We're Looking For
Essential
- Proven full-cycle B2B SaaS sales experience, with a track record of closing new business
- Comfortable running conversations with senior stakeholders (CFO, HR Director, Procurement Director, Tax) at large organisations
- Confident building your own pipeline, not just working what's handed to you
- Disciplined CRM habits and forecast accuracy
- Self-starter and coachable, with the confidence to challenge the approach when you've spotted something better
Desirable
- Experience selling into Procurement, Tax, Finance, HR or Legal functions
- Background in compliance, RegTech, HR-tech or workforce management software
- Experience in an early-stage, venture-backed environment
- Familiarity with longer, multi-stakeholder sales cycles and multi-year contract structures
Commercial Structure
This is a full-time, permanent role.
Base salary £55,000 to £70,000 DOE, plus commission, OTE £125,000. Based at Alderley Park, Cheshire, with hybrid working.
